Among the highlights this month are the debut of the new adventure film “The Electric State,” starring the talented Millie Bobby Brown, a previously delayed cookery series with Meghan Markle due to the Los Angeles wildfires, and a one-shot drama called “Adolescence” from the dynamic duo behind “Boiling Point,” Stephen Graham, and Philip Barantini.
Adding to the mix is a compelling new true-crime documentary from the acclaimed director Errol Morris, known for the seminal film “The Thin Blue Line.” This documentary will delve into the enigmatic world of the Manson family murders, challenging the official narratives of one of the most notorious killing sprees of the 1960s. Morris himself expressed intrigue in exploring the mystery behind how Manson could influence those around him to commit such heinous acts.
